What is Unicode character 𰳻?

The Unicode character 𰳻 U+30CFB is Cjk Unified Ideograph- in the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ension G block.

What does the Unicode character 𰳻 represent?

The Unicode character 𰳻 represents Cjk Unified Ideograph-.

What is the Unicode code point for 𰳻?

The Unicode code point for 𰳻 is U+30CFB.

Is the appearance of the 𰳻 character consistent across all platforms?

The appearance of the 𰳻 character can vary slightly across different platforms and devices due to differences in font and rendering. However, the general design of the Cjk Unified Ideograph- remains consistent.

How can I ensure the 𰳻 character displays correctly on different devices?

Though using Unicode ensures consistent display across devices and platforms. Ensure that the font being used supports the Han script to correctly render the 𰳻 character.

In which version was Unicode character 𰳻 released, and to which block of characters does it belong?

Unicode character 𰳻 was first introduced in Unicode Version 13.0, and it belongs to the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ension G block of characters.
